Safeguarding Your Car Against Nature’s Fury

In order to protect your beloved automobile from the wrath of hurricanes, there are several key steps you must take. Firstly, it is imperative to inspect your tires thoroughly. Ensure they have adequate tread depth and are properly inflated as this will enhance traction on wet roads during heavy rainfall.

Secondly, pay close attention to your windshield wipers. These unsung heroes play a vital role in maintaining visibility during torrential downpours. Replace worn-out blades promptly and consider applying a hydrophobic coating on the glass surface for improved water repellency.

Furthermore, do not overlook the importance of checking all exterior lights before embarking on any journey amidst hurricane season. Functional headlights, taillights, brake lights, and turn signals are essential not only for your safety but also for other drivers who may be navigating treacherous conditions alongside you.

Maintaining Optimal Performance Amidst Adversity

A well-maintained engine can make all the difference when facing challenging circumstances brought about by hurricanes. Regular oil changes and air filter replacements contribute significantly towards ensuring optimal performance even in adverse weather conditions.

Additionally, paying heed to fluid levels such as coolant or antifreeze can prevent overheating issues while driving through flooded areas or enduring prolonged periods of idling due to traffic congestion caused by evacuation efforts.

Moreover, keeping an eye on battery health is crucial during hurricane season. Extreme weather conditions can place additional strain on your vehicle’s battery, so it is advisable to have it tested and replaced if necessary before the storm hits.

Securing Your Vehicle in Preparation for the Storm

Prior to a hurricane making landfall, taking proactive measures to secure your car can save you from potential damage. If possible, park your vehicle in a garage or covered area to shield it from falling debris or flying objects propelled by strong winds.

In case sheltered parking is not available, consider investing in a sturdy car cover designed specifically for protection against extreme weather events. Ensure that the cover fits snugly over your vehicle and fasten any straps securely to prevent it from being blown away by gusty winds.

Lastly, do not forget about important documents such as insurance papers and registration details. Keep them safely stored in waterproof bags within your vehicle’s glove compartment or center console so that they remain accessible even amidst chaotic situations.
